Guide to Models

Each of the following models (A, B, AA, and BB) are fitted to the data from each study separately. When fitted to the pooled data, an additional predictor, study_name is added after the intercept.

predictors/model A B AA BB best
age age_in_years_70 age_in_years_70 age_in_years_70 age_in_years_70 ?
sex female female female female ?
education educ3 educ3 educ3 educ3 ?
marital status single single single single ?
health poor_health poor_health ?
physical activity sedentary sedentary ?
employment current_work current_work ?
alcohol use current_drink_2 current_drink_2 ?
INTERACTIONS NONE NONE ALL PAIRWISE ALL PAIRWISE ?

Odds-ratios with 95% confidence intervals are reported. The model labeled “best” represents the solution suggested by the top ranked model from the best subset search propelled by genetic algorithm with AICC as the guiding selection criteria.
